Team,

As discussed, we are recording a write-down on the Sellowbrook accessory range following the discontinuation of the Varn 3 handset. Affected stock across the Kettleford and Mirehaven branches totals roughly 8,000 units. Branch managers should complete counts by Friday and route clearance pricing through regional approval. Finance will post the adjustment in the June close. No customer-facing changes yet. Please review the confidential planning note appended below before briefing your teams.

board note of kageg-bahof: The renewal with Holwynax Holdings closes at $2 million a year, 5 percent below the last contract. Project Ulaath slips by two quarters because of the supplier delay.

### TKT-4471: Signature check failing on paginated responses

Welcome aboard! Quick context: the public Ferndock REST API signs each response page, and clients verify before following the `next` cursor. Since Tuesday, page two and onward fail verification intermittently. Best guess is the edge cache is serving pages signed with the pre-rotation key while page one comes from origin. Can you confirm by comparing signatures across pages? For reference when testing locally, responses should currently validate against the active key below.

deploy key for kajof-fajop: bky6_gDHw9Q

Subject: Weather-alert fan-out — status for weekly sync

Team,

The Stormlane fan-out service is now pushing severe-weather alerts to all three delivery tiers in under two seconds at p99. We resolved the backlog issue from last week by batching the Kestrel queue writes and dropping the per-subscriber lock. Remaining work: dedupe logic for overlapping county polygons, owned by Priya's group, targeting next sprint. Load test against the Havermill scenario passed this morning. The candidate build under review is:

session token of tajef-bageg = htk21_5d90d574934f3ccae6437